可视化站点拨测是一种用于监测网站或网络服务可用性和性能的技术。在双十二这样的大型购物活动中,网站流量会显著增加,因此确保网站的高可用性和快速响应至关重要。以下是关于可视化站点拨测的基础概念、优势、类型、应用场景以及可能遇到的问题和解决方法。
可视化站点拨测是通过模拟用户访问网站的行为,定期检查网站的可用性和性能。它通常包括以下几个方面:
原因:
解决方法:
原因:
解决方法:
原因:
解决方法:
以下是一个简单的主动拨测示例,使用requests
库来检查网站的可用性:
import requests
import time
def check_website(url):
try:
response = requests.get(url, timeout=5)
if response.status_code == 200:
print(f"{url} is up and running!")
else:
print(f"{url} returned status code {response.status_code}")
except requests.RequestException as e:
print(f"{url} is down: {e}")
if __name__ == "__main__":
websites = ["https://example.com", "https://example.org"]
while True:
for site in websites:
check_website(site)
time.sleep(60) # 每分钟检查一次
通过这种方式,可以定期监控多个网站的可用性,并及时发现和处理问题。
希望这些信息对你有所帮助!如果有更多具体问题,欢迎继续咨询。
领取专属 10元无门槛券
手把手带您无忧上云